Do thicker sway bars make a difference?

A larger sway bar is not necessarily stiffer. … Stiffer sway bars are not always better. While increasing the stiffness of the rear sway bar in a front wheel drive car might reduce understeer, an overly stiff rear sway bar can actually induce oversteer and make the car difficult to drive.

How does sway bar affect handling?

Basically sway bars reduce roll and dramatically improve handling. They connect one side of the suspension to the other with attachment points generally on the lower A-arms and frame (chassis), and twist to limit the roll during cornering. As the truck enters a corner, centrifugal forces create a body roll force.

Can I drive without sway bar?

Vehicles can be driven safely without a sway bar or with it disconnected. The vehicle does feel different while cornering but is not “uncontrollable”. Just take corners at legal posted speeds or lower and be careful changing lanes on the highway.

What does a bigger front sway bar do?

The fitting of larger sway bars (rear and in general) has two main effects, vehicle balance in terms of understeer and oversteer, and increased roll resistance. Both of these can provide increased overall grip levels that can be achieved by the vehicle.

Is a sway bar and stabilizer bar the same?

Also known as a stabilizer bar or anti-roll bar, the sway bar connects suspension components on either side of the car to minimize body leaning in turns.

Do sway bars increase traction?

Sway bars do not change the overall traction of your car or truck, they just affect your side grip in a corner. While a thick heavy weight sway bar so stiffly connects both sides of your suspension resulting in what feels like a straight axle suspension.

Do sway bars reduce traction?

Sway bars do not change the overall traction of your car or truck, they just affect your side grip in a corner. … Adjusting sway bars is a balancing act, increase stiffness to a sway bar on one end, reduces the side grip of that axle, while increasing the side grip on the other end.

Do sway bars stiffen suspension?

Well-engineered sway bars will not result in a stiff ride. They complement the suspension but do not overpower them. However, bigger is not always better – you can go too big! If you go too big, the suspension won’t be able to twist the sway bar properly, which would result in a stiff ride.

Are front or rear sway bars more important?

The general rule of thumb is that a rear wheel drive vehicle will benefit from a front sway bar, while a front-wheel drive will benefit from a rear sway bar. In a front wheel drive, rear sway bars keep the weight distribution across the tires as even as possible.

How do I choose a sway bar?

Determine which tires you are going to run. Select the springs you’ll run based on tires, track layout and conditions. Select which sway bar is right for you. Adjust wheel alignment to suit, keeping in mind a more aggressive sway bar usually requires more aggressive alignment settings.

How can I make my FWD car handle better?

Basics – a stiffer rear sway bar will reduce understeer. Lower the car moderately (1-2 inches.) Stiffer springs reduce roll, but go to stiffer shocks, too! Put more and better rubber on the ground.

How tight should sway bar links be?

Tighten the sway bar link nut using a combination wrench to hold the bolt head and a torque wrench and socket to tighten the nut. Use caution when tightening the link: it only requires light torque, typically 10 to 20 foot-pounds.

How do I know if my sway bar is bad?

Warning signs of a broken or bad sway bar link include clunks and squeaks. Over-steering or excessive lean through turns are also symptoms of worn sway bar links, but they can also be signs of larger problems with your vehicle’s suspension system.

Is it safe to drive with broken sway bar link?

If you suspect that a sway bar is broken, you can still drive the car, but you must use caution. … It will feel “looser”, particularly when driving at high speeds. It’s very possible that this will cause you to lose control of the car, resulting in a serious accident if you’re not prepared for it.

How much does it cost to replace sway bars?

The average sway bar link replacement cost is usually between $125 to $160 including labor. The links themselves cost between $40 to $110 each, while the labor will set you back anywhere between $50 to $70.

What is death wobble?

Death wobble is used to describe a series of sudden, often violent front suspension vibrations exhibited by solid front axle suspensions, and more infrequently, independent front suspensions. … Even just one death wobble incident can cause permanent—and dangerous—suspension or steering damage.

What causes death wobble?

What Causes the Death Wobble? In most cases, the death wobble will occur when driving at speeds of at least 45 miles per hour and can be triggered by hitting a bump or pothole. Some of the most common causes of the death wobble include poorly installed suspension parts or loose or damaged steering components.

Do sway bars help towing?

Installing a sway bar helps reduce the body roll and sway you will see on the tow vehicle, but does very little in preventing the trailer from swaying. Installing a weight distribution hitch with sway control will be the best option for preventing trailer sway.
